HR Information Bulletin 9: The Duty to Disclose Adverse Information

Year Developed: 2017

Resource Type: Publication.

Primary Audience: n.a.

Language(s): English

Developed by: National Association of Community Health Centers (See other resources developed by this organization).

Resource Summary: This document addresses federal reporting requirements for health centers when a clinical privileging action is taken against a health care practitioner.
